Tim Ryan family donates $1 million to Olympic College Poulsbo campus; sonography lab to bear family name
Summary
Olympic College announced a $1,000,000 gift from the Tim Ryan family to equip new allied-health programs at the Poulsbo campus. College interim president Joan Hampton told the Poulsbo City Council the gift will buy cutting-edge training equipment and that the sonography lab will be named the Tim Ryan Family Diagnostic Medical Sonography Lab.
POULSBO, Wash. — Olympic College has received a $1,000,000 donation from the Tim Ryan family to support a newly expanding allied-health suite at the college’s Poulsbo campus, Interim President Joan Hampton told the Poulsbo City Council on Aug. 20.
